What is a Crawl Space Drainage System? 

crawl space drainage pipe

Crawl space drainage systems manage crawl space moisture. These systems typically include a 4-inch corrugated and perforated pipe, often encased in a silt sock to prevent clogging.

This pipe is installed in trenches dug along the perimeter of the crawl space and then covered with gravel. When water enters the pipe, it is directed toward a sump pump system, which removes the water from the crawl space.

What Are the Benefits of Crawl Space Drainage Installation? 

When integrated with other crawl space encapsulation essentials, crawl space drainage provides many benefits: 

father and son playing on couch in clean home
  • Improved Air Quality: Lowering moisture levels reduces musty odors, producing cleaner indoor air. 
  • Enhanced Structural Stability: Proper drainage prevents wood rot and foundation erosion.
  • Decreased Energy Bills: Reduced humidity boosts HVAC efficiency, leading to energy savings.

We can offer your home either an interior or an exterior drainage system. As their names imply, these systems are installed along the interior and exterior of your home respectively.

    The interior drainage system is installed in the floor and along the walls of your crawl space, which is where most water tends to gather when it floods. The exterior drainage system will be installed along the outside perimeter of your home and will collect any water that gathers out here instead. An interior drainage system will then redirect this water to the sump pump, which in turn will deposit this water out into a nearby storm drain or other drainage trench far away from your home.

    An exterior drainage system can benefit your home, as well. Rather than relying on a storm drain far from your home, exterior drains redirect water out onto your lawn. The cap over the drain prevents water from spilling back in and flooding your home. These systems are also guaranteed to never clog. Should any mud, dirt, or other debris flow inside, these drainage systems will then push it out along with any excess water that tries to get into your home.
